THE LITTLE WHITE HOUSE 197 The service man watched him with de tached smile. The old man s silly shrewdness amused him. He suspected him of a cask or two in the cellar. In the days of bicycles the old man had driven a lively trade; but with the long- reaching cars, his business dribbled away, and he had slipped back from whiskey to potatoes. He was a little disgruntled at events, and would talk socialism by the hour to anyone who would listen. But he was a harmless old soul. The service man gla
...nced at the sun. It had dipped suddenly, and the plain grew dusky black. The dis tant figures hoeing against the plain were lost to sight. "Hallo!" said the service man quickly, "we must get on " Pie looked again, shrewdly, toward the old man in the dusk "You couldn t find a drop of anything, handy to give away Jimmie?" he suggested.
The old man tottered a slow smile at him and moved toward the house. He 198 MR. ACHILLES came back with a long-necked bottle grasped tight, and a couple of glasses that he filled in the dimness.
